Modul "Motor Control with Real-Time Microcontrollers"

| Lecturer | Tian, Wei, M.Sc. |
| ECTS | 6 |
| Content | Practical Training: 4 SWS |
| Cycle | Winter term |
| Time & Room | Room 0901 time schedule |
| Links | TUMonline |
| Language of instruction | English |
|---|
Objectives
After successful participation in the module, the student is able to:
- design and optimize controllers for a PMSM,
- understand the operation of power electronic actuators,
- use simulation tools (e.g., MATLAB / Simulink) to investigate the behavior of mechatronic systems,
- use the integrated development environment (IDE) to develop the embedded code for a PMSM drive system,
- understand the operation of the microcontroller (hardware) and use the embedded code (software) to control the PMSM,
- apply different measuring methods in the laboratory
- analyze and evaluate the obtained measurement data.
- design and optimize controllers for a PMSM,
- understand the operation of power electronic actuators,
- use simulation tools (e.g., MATLAB / Simulink) to investigate the behavior of mechatronic systems,
- use the integrated development environment (IDE) to develop the embedded code for a PMSM drive system,
- understand the operation of the microcontroller (hardware) and use the embedded code (software) to control the PMSM,
- apply different measuring methods in the laboratory
- analyze and evaluate the obtained measurement data.
Description
This module consists of a series of microcontroller-based experiments with the following content being covered:
- Implementation of Open-Loop Control for a PMSM in an Embedded Software Development Environment (e.g. TI CCStudio),
- Implementation of Field-Oriented Control for a PMSM in an Embedded Development Environment,
- Implementation of Open-Loop Control for a PMSM in a Model-Based Design Environment (e.g. PLECS),
- Implementation of Field-Oriented Control for a PMSM in a Model-Based Design Environment,
-Implementation of Offline Parameter Identification for a PMSM in a Model-Based Design Environment
- Implementation of Open-Loop Control for a PMSM in an Embedded Software Development Environment (e.g. TI CCStudio),
- Implementation of Field-Oriented Control for a PMSM in an Embedded Development Environment,
- Implementation of Open-Loop Control for a PMSM in a Model-Based Design Environment (e.g. PLECS),
- Implementation of Field-Oriented Control for a PMSM in a Model-Based Design Environment,
-Implementation of Offline Parameter Identification for a PMSM in a Model-Based Design Environment
Prerequisites
In order to participate successfully in the module, knowledge is strongly required in the following areas:
- linear control theory,
- programming language such as C,
- knowledge for control of electrical machines,
- operation of simulation software such as MATLAB/Simulink or PLECS.
For this reason, the following modules should already be successfully completed before participation:
- "Control of Electrical Drives Part II - Advanced Control Strategies" (EI78019)
- "Laboratory on Simulation of Controlled Electrical Drives" (EI7368/EI80003)
- linear control theory,
- programming language such as C,
- knowledge for control of electrical machines,
- operation of simulation software such as MATLAB/Simulink or PLECS.
For this reason, the following modules should already be successfully completed before participation:
- "Control of Electrical Drives Part II - Advanced Control Strategies" (EI78019)
- "Laboratory on Simulation of Controlled Electrical Drives" (EI7368/EI80003)